Consider the hypothesis test H0: σ21 = σ22 against H1: σ21 ≠ σ22. Suppose that the sample sizes are n1 = 15 and n2 = 15, and the sample variances are s21 = 2.3 and s22 = 1.9. Use α = 0.05.
(a) Test the hypothesis and explain how the test could be conducted with a confidence interval on σ1 / σ2.
(b) What is the power of the test in part (a) if σ1 is twice as large as σ2?
(c) Assuming equal sample sizes, what sample size should be used to obtain β = 0.05 if the σ2 is half of σ1?
